Safe Standing: Roker End

Sunderland AFC confirmed on Tuesday morning that safe standing will be introduced at the Stadium of Light for the 2024-25 season.

 

Following this announcement, we understand that supporters currently located in the Roker End may have a range of questions relating to their season ticket renewal.

 

Fans are advised that rails will be installed across blocks U14 and U37, from row 23, and blocks U38 and U39, from row 24.

We understand that some fans may no longer wish to be situated in the area now designated for safe standing and moving seat ahead of the 2024-25 season couldn’t be easier.

 

When renewing your season ticket, simply select an alternative seat when completing the purchase process via your online e-ticketing account.

 

Alternatively, you can renew your existing seat as planned and email safestanding@safc.com to request a seat move, with this process set to take place from Monday 6 May. The ticket office will prioritise this request and contact you to discuss available options from that point onward.

 

We will also support fans located in blocks U40 and U13, who will be situated next to the area designated for safe standing, if they wish to move seats following the start of the season.

 

Fans wishing to move into the area designated for safe standing should renew their existing season ticket as planned before expressing an interest by emailing safestanding@safc.com by Friday 3 May.
